Coventry deeds and papers

Description

Gift with warranty from Henry le Baxtere of Coventr' to Sir William, baillif of Coventr', chaplain, of a tenement lying opposite the Cross in the market place (alto foro) between the tenement which Nicholas le Perci holds and the tenement which William de Lynne formerly held; also a corner tenement lying at the Broad gate (latam portam) in Coventr' between the tenement of Roger Oky and the tenement of Walter le Whitewebbe; also all his lands tenements rents etc. with the incidents of wardship, marriage, reliefs, heriots, escheats, suit of court and all other profits which he has in the vill of Keresleye; to hold the same of the chief lord of the fee. Witnesses: Jordan de Shepeye, John de Weston', William Graunpe, Nicholas Percy, Henry de Melton', Roger del Newelond, Elias de Stokwelle of Keresleye, Henry Bulbek' of the same, Thomas de la Fermerie, clerk, and others. Dated at Coventr', Monday next after the feast of St. Mark the Evangelist, 16 Edward III. Tag, seal lost. Endorsed: i) Munimentum Guydonis le Meryngton' et Agnetis uxoris eius ii) also sketch of a dimidiated shield: a fess impaling a bond sinister.
